Rome still wins for creating amazing structures made of concrete without metal to further support it - our projects all use metal in combination with concrete, and thus the "superiority" cannot be attributed to the concrete alone. The metal bears more of the brunt and has allowed us to span longer distances, and not need pillars etc. So if metal reinforced concrete is what you consider "superior" concrete, then yes, but the concrete, the stone and sand and binding agents on their own, no, are not superior to the ancients concrete. It's not the concrete itself that is superior - the concrete often cracks and chips away - just look at the bridge supports in toronto and the skyway bridge - that isn't "superior" concrete - its the introduction of metal support within the concrete that makes us able to build stronger, taller, bigger, but that very addition of metal means that over time they most likely will not last as long as time affects the metal, whereas with ancient roman concrete, time only strengthens it.
Without human intervention in 1000 years most of our structures will have collapsed as the metal slowly rusts and expands and contracts within the concrete, cracking it and causing chunks to fall off. Roman structures made of concrete, while perhaps weathered, were still standing during that time period. We can create grander higher and longer structures yes, but they will not last as long.
